Boeing’s hidden costs of its reputation crisis. Shifting expectations among four stakeholder groups have, altered behaviors, reduced the value of expectations, and reduced Boeing’s bottom line. Boeing’s equity under performance <\/a>is a reflection of shareholders’ expectations of a lowered net income. Triggered by a loss trust and credibility, customers are having their own engineers inspect product; Boeing is inspecting subcontractors’ product; regulators are inspecting Boeing’s product; and machinists are demanding a major wage boost.<\/p>\n\n\n\n Click on the image above to read more<\/strong> (No Paywall).<\/p>\n\n\n\n
